Midland College Baseball Ranked 25th in First NJCAA DI Poll, Opens Season at Wharton County Junior College
The Midland College baseball finished the 2025 season at 46-11 and advanced to the NJCAA Region 5 Baseball Regional Round of the post-season.

The Midland College Chaparrals baseball team will open the 2026 season on the road versus Wharton County Junior College. The Chaps, ranked 25th in the NJCAA Preseason poll, were scheduled to open the season on January 24th and 25th in a three-game series versus Alvin Community College, in San Antonio however freezing cold weather all across Texas forced the cancelation of those games.
The Chaps traveled to Wharton, TX to open the season versus the WCJC Pioneers on Wednesday and Thursday. Those games were originally schedule to be played at the University of the Incarnate Word in San Antonio, on Friday and Saturday, however, a scheduling conflict at the UIW baseball field compelled the WCJC and MC coaches to work on a schedule modification.
On Wednesday, January 28th the Chaparrals and Pioneers will play a double-header beginning at 2:00 p.m. The two teams will also play a single game on Thursday, January 29th. That game is scheduled for a 1:00 p.m. first pitch.
The 2026 season is the 25th anniversary of the Midland College Chaparrals baseball team. This season the Chaps will wear commemorative patches on their game caps in recognition of the program's proud history of excellence.
The MC baseball program played their inaugural season under the guidance of Steve Ramharter. Ramharter recorded a 206-84 overall record in 5+ seasons as head coach. Replacing Ramharter was David Coleman. Coleman is the all-time wins leader at Midland College, going 412-241-1 in his 11 seasons at the helm.
Stepping up to stewart the team beginning in 2018 was Hector Rodriguez. Rodriguez joined the Chaparrals as Ramharter's assistant in the 2006 season. Ramharter departed the program that same year with Rodriguez serving as the interim head coach. Coach Rod then served as assistant coach for Coleman for 11 seasons before being selected to replace him.
Rodriguez has served as head coach for 8+ seasons, including a 34-game stint as interim head coach in 2006. Rodriguez is second in career coaching wins in Midland College program history with a 315-136 overall record (includes 27-7 in 2006).
The Chaps finished 2025 with an impressive 46-11 record and a second place finish in the WJCAC. Top returnees for the Chaparrals include Dylon Myrow, Augden Hallmark, Luke Wheatley, Logan Flores, Jorge Gil and AJ Velarde.

MC is expected to contend for the WJCAC Championship this season with stiff competition coming from the usual conference opponents, including New Mexico Junior College, Odessa College, Howard College, Amarillo College and the New Mexico Military Institute. This season the Chaparrals will play games against several teams ranked in the NJCAA's Division I Baseball Preseason Polls, including: #1 Salt Lake Community College, #6 McLennan Community College and #7 Weatherford College.
Following the trip to Wharton, Midland College will open the home portion of the season on February 6th and 7th when they host Trinidad State Junior College in a three-game series at Christensen Stadium.
